Moderators Tom Denham Posted December 2, 2012 Moderators Share Posted December 2, 2012 There are several possibilities I can think of. If eating the amount of protein and fat recommended with the Whole30 is a notable increase for you, your gut may not be prepared to digest it. Many people find that taking a digestive enzyme such as Now Foods Super Enzymes helps while their bodies adjust to digesting fat and protein. If you are not used to eating a lot of vegetables or you are eating different vegetables than you are accustomed to, your body may be struggling with it. I don't think digestive enzymes do much with veggies, but it is important if you are sensitive to make sure your veggies are well cooked. Raw veggies are harder to digest.
